WebCow’s milk protein allergy (CMPA) is an immune- mediated reaction to various proteins in cow’s milk. It is the most common food protein allergy in infants and children [1]. The reaction may be IgE-mediated, non-IgE mediated or mixed. CMPA may have cutaneous, respiratory and/or gastrointestinal manifestations.
